Manual Arts Studio
The fully equipped manual arts facility was opened in 2002 complete with up-to-date equipment including bench drill, drill press, lathe and bench saw.
Students are encouraged to design their own projects completing pieces that both interest them and challenge their skills.
The spacious workshop style environment is a significant step away from conventional classroom based facilities of the past and is designed to give students a real life work experience setting.
Technology Room
The modern, air conditioned Computer Laboratory consists of 25 networked computers. All computers are fitted and protected by Content Keeper hardware the same used by the Australian Defence Force. This is updated hourly ensuring your child’s protection and safety whilst using this resource. The College’s computers were all replaced in 2008 and operate the latest in software programs.
Visual Art Studio
The Visual Art Studio provides students from Years 7-12 with the chance to practice art in a creative, natural environment.
The Visual Art department focuses on offering students the chance to play, make, create, appreciate and experience the visual arts from a variety of cultures and historical periods.
The studio is well resourced and equipped and includes a full sized kiln.
